Tragic Road Accident Claims Life of Telangana Lawmaker: BRS MLA Lasya Nanditha Mourned

Telangana's Bharat Rashtra Samithi (BRS) MLA Lasya Nanditha tragically lost her life in a road accident on Sultanpur Outer Ring Road in Sangareddy. The incident occurred when an XL 6 car collided with a divider. Telangana CM expressed deep condolences over the loss.

Telangana was struck by a devastating blow as news emerged of the tragic demise of Bharat Rashtra Samithi (BRS) MLA Lasya Nanditha in a fatal road accident. The incident unfolded on Sultanpur Outer Ring Road (ORR) in Sangareddy, under the jurisdiction of Aminpur Mandal. Nanditha, a beloved lawmaker known for her dedication to public service, was traveling in an XL 6 car when the unforeseen tragedy occurred.

Eyewitnesses reported that the vehicle lost control and collided with a divider, resulting in severe injuries to Nanditha and the driver. Despite immediate medical attention, Nanditha succumbed to her injuries upon arrival at the hospital. The driver, critically injured in the accident, is currently undergoing treatment.

The entire state of Telangana mourns the loss of MLA Lasya Nanditha, expressing shock and disbelief at the sudden turn of events. Telangana Chief Minister, Revnath Reddy, expressed profound grief and extended heartfelt condolences to Nanditha's family, friends, and supporters. Reddy hailed Nanditha as a dedicated public servant, emphasizing her unwavering commitment to social justice and equitable development.

The tragic accident comes as a double blow to the community, occurring within a year of Nanditha's father's passing. Sayanna, a respected five-time MLA from the same constituency, had passed away due to illness on February 19 of the previous year. The loss of both father and daughter within such a short span of time has left the region reeling with grief.

Just days before the fatal accident, Nanditha had narrowly escaped another potential disaster while traveling from a meeting in Nalgonda. The community breathed a collective sigh of relief at her fortunate escape, unaware of the impending tragedy that would soon unfold.
